Output 81f4d938c708d205a1113117cbe75e7a32df5bea0024f1a1829775d6f5f77bd9:15

value
2654464
script pubkey
OP_0 OP_PUSHBYTES_20 bca44447028bc65435102e935557321fee1bba61
address
bc1qhjjyg3cz30r9gdgs96f424ejrlhphwnpmx4jm4
transaction
81f4d938c708d205a1113117cbe75e7a32df5bea0024f1a1829775d6f5f77bd9